課程內容大綱 Course Description
The purpose of this course is to introduce non-Americans to the diversity and complexity of American culture. The reasons for understanding culture are many:
· it enriches one's language ability to be able to culturally contextualize language usage;
· it makes reading American newspapers, magazines and literature easier as one can grasp the background more easily;
· it opens doors to intercultural communication.
In this class we will be using short readings from the text Contemporary America by Russell Duncan & Joseph Goddard (written for non-Americans and non-English speakers), newspaper and magazine articles. We will also be watching Hollywood films of contemporary American life and then having guided discussions of the cultural aspects of those films.
